I have just recieved my grandmothers marriage certificate,she was born in Kent == Harriett Sutton,she married Cornelius White in Portsmouth in 1899. Her father is listed as Samson Sutton fisherman. I searched and searched and the only reference I can find for Samson is in 1881 census, he is listed as a widower living Hastings, aged 61. Any help would be appreciated.

Hi there

According to 1901 Census, Harriet  the wife of Cornelius WHITE, and mother of 1 yr old Eliza Was age 21 and born approx 1880 in Folkestone Kent.

Does her age on marriage cert also indicate she was born around 1880?

http://www.rootschat.com/forum/index.php/topic,216999.0.html
you say:
Her father was a hawker,traveller, fisherman.
She was born Folkestone Kent ..... married July 1899 her fathers name is listed as Samson Sutton, fisherman. Witnesses are Ebenezer White and Mary Ann Hewett .  Cornelius's parents Ebenezer and Mary White at 8 Warblington Street Portsmouth. This address was confirmed as correct by a cousin.
Her father was a hawker,traveller, fisherman.


http://www.rootschat.com/forum/index.php/topic,46723.0.html
you say:
I know very little about (Harriet)  except that she came from Kent and was from a gypsy family, and that her family shunned her because she did'nt marry a gypsy.  Some time in later life she married again to an Edward Biggs.

It would be interesting to see who Harriet names as her father on her marriage to BIGGS.  Do you know who the witness Mary Ann HEWETT was when she married Cornelius?

The Sampson SUTTON b abt 1820 Hastings.
He is the one Sam*son SUTTON who comes up with occupation  "FIsherman" -  but I don't think that's enough to settle on him as Harriet's father - especially if he may also have been a "Hawker" and "Traveller" . 

In 1881, that Samson the fisherman is a widower age 61 living in Hastings with his married daughter Emma age 38 (Mrs Jonathon DIBLEY).  In 1891, he appears to be age 72, Fisherman & boarding  with an elderly  couple named MOORE in Hastings (who may be related) ; in 1901, he is 82, a retired Fisherman &  living with daughter Emma who is now age 57 remarried as Mrs Willam DENGATE - in Hastings.

Doesn't look a promising candidate so far?

As for Harriet - what address did she give on the marriage certificate?

Only mentioning these because of the Hastings connection.

The IGI has a couple of extracted marriages for a Samson SUTTON in Hastings, both at St Clements.

1.  to an Ann BALL, 23 Oct 1838
2.  to a Jane SMITH, 23 Jul 1870.

Not sure if they are the same person or father and son, but could be the latter because of a Samson Sutton birth at Hastings Dec qtr 1840.

There are quite a few other Samson Suttons on the IGI in other counties.

Samson Sutton death aged 88 Sep qtr 1907 at Hastings 2b 6

That Samson (indexed as Samuel) in 1871 was 53 with his wife Jane aged 60, a fisherman born Hastings, and deaf.
